Ask Dr. Universe: How many suns are in the universe?

Dr-Universe-230OLYMPIA, Wash. – Our sun is really one big star. And there are billions and billions of stars in our universe.

Dr-U-in-space“More than we can even count,” added my friend Phil Lou. He’s an expert on solar energy here at Washington State University. He’s really curious about finding ways to power homes and schools using energy from the sun.

“Most of the energy and life around us that we know is linked to the sun,” he explained. Then we put on our sunglasses, slathered on some sunscreen and headed out to explore.
